8:00a: wake up, brush teeth, sit on potty, and play (wants to play more in the morning)

9:00a: breakfast (5 oz of whole milk, 1/2 banana, 1 egg omelet, and a slice of bacon or sausage patty)

9:30a: play outside in the garden (obsessed with going out)

10:00a: get ready for the day (get dressed and pack a snack)

10:30a: go on an outing (playgroup, swim lessons/pool/splash pad, or run errands)

12:00p: eat lunch (4 ounces of protein [1 egg, beef, turkey, or chicken], 4 ounces of veggies)

12:30p: play with cars, trains, and trucks, and more cars (he's definitely a boy)

1:00p: sit on potty, read books, then take a nap

3:30p: have a snack...a sippy cup (5 oz) of whole milk, fruit, and cheese

4:00p: go on an outing (run errands; too hot for the park these days)

5:00p: play in kitchen while i clean up a bit and get dinner ready (coloring book, scooter, or bang bowls)

6:00p: bike ride with mama and daddy

6:30p: dinner (4 ounces of poultry, fish or beef, 4 ounces of veggies, and fruit for dessert)

7:00p: sit on potty, then bath time

7:30p: get dressed for bed, brush teeth, cuddle up, and read books

8:00p: bedtime
